Does anybody use large rubbermaid tubs for enclosures?

I was wondering do any of you use large rubbermaid tubs for your beardeds. I am thinking of useing a large tub and attach a clamp light to the top to make a basking spot. I mean its not great looking like a cage but it will do while they grow and then I can build something when they get older. I actually use rubbermaid tubs for my babies. It works great because they are easy to remove from the racking and very easy to clean. If you use a racking system its very easy to set up and not very expensive either, all you need is a steel shelving unit, lights, rubbermaids to fit on the self and your set.
